The Effects of EMS-Combined Body Awareness Exercises on Non-Specific Low Back Pain

Brief Summary
Low back pain is one of the most prevalent musculoskeletal conditions worldwide and is a leading cause of disability and reduced quality of life. Non-specific low back pain (NSLBP), which has no identifiable underlying pathology, accounts for the majority of low back pain cases and often requires a multidisciplinary rehabilitation approach. Body awareness-based exercises aim to improve postural control, movement quality, and the individual's perception of bodily sensations, and have been shown to be beneficial in chronic pain management. Electrical muscle stimulation (EMS) is a non-invasive modality that enhances neuromuscular activation and may support functional recovery when combined with exercise interventions. The purpose of this study is to investigate the effects of EMS-combined body awareness exercises on pain intensity, functional disability, and body awareness in individuals with non-specific low back pain. Participants will be randomly assigned to either an intervention group receiving EMS-assisted body awareness training or a control group receiving standard body awareness exercises. Outcome measures will be assessed before and after the intervention period. This study aims to provide evidence on whether the addition of EMS to body awareness-based rehabilitation leads to superior clinical outcomes compared to body awareness exercises alone in individuals with non-specific low back pain.

Outcome Measures
Primary Outcomes (2)
Functional Disability
Functional disability will be evaluated using the Oswestry Disability Index (ODI), which assesses the impact of low back pain on daily activities such as walking, sitting, standing, and lifting. Higher scores indicate greater levels of disability.
Baseline (Week 0) and Week 8
Pain intensity
Pain intensity will be assessed using the Numeric Rating Scale (NRS), where participants rate their current low back pain intensity on an 11-point scale ranging from 0 (no pain) to 10 (worst imaginable pain). Study Arms (2)
EMS-Assisted Body Awareness Exercise Group
EXPERIMENTALParticipants in this group will receive a structured body awareness-based exercise program combined with electrical muscle stimulation (EMS). EMS will be applied to the lumbar and related trunk muscles during selected exercise components in order to enhance neuromuscular activation and sensorimotor integration. The intervention will be delivered by trained physiotherapists under standardized clinical conditions.
Exercise Group
ACTIVE COMPARATORParticipants in this group will receive the same structured body awareness-based exercise program without electrical muscle stimulation. The program will focus on posture, breathing, movement quality, and proprioceptive awareness, and will be delivered by trained physiotherapists under standardized clinical conditions.
Interventions
This intervention consists of a body awareness-based rehabilitation program supported by electrical muscle stimulation. EMS will be applied to the lumbar and trunk muscles during selected exercises to facilitate muscle activation, improve postural control, and enhance sensorimotor awareness. The exercise program will include postural alignment, breathing regulation, controlled movement patterns, and proprioceptive training.
This intervention consists of a structured body awareness-based exercise program focusing on postural control, breathing, movement quality, and proprioceptive awareness. Exercises will be performed without any electrical stimulation and will be supervised by trained physiotherapists
Eligibility Criteria
You may qualify if:
- Aged between 18 and 65 years
- Diagnosed with non-specific low back pain for at least 3 months
- Pain intensity of ≥4 on the Numeric Rating Scale (NRS)
- Ability to understand and follow exercise instructions
- Willingness to participate in the study and provide written informed consent
You may not qualify if:
- Specific causes of low back pain (e.g., disc herniation with neurological deficit, spinal stenosis, spondylolisthesis, fracture, infection, tumor)
- History of spinal surgery within the last 12 months
- Known neurological disorders affecting movement or sensation
- Diagnosed rheumatological or inflammatory diseases (e.g., ankylosing spondylitis, rheumatoid arthritis)
- Pregnancy
- Presence of cardiac pacemaker or implanted electronic devices (contraindication for EMS)
- Severe osteoporosis or other conditions contraindicating exercise
- Current participation in another structured physiotherapy or rehabilitation program
- Cognitive impairment or psychiatric conditions limiting cooperation with the protocol
